Tomcat 的缺省配置是不能稳定长期运行的,也就是不适合生产环境,它会死机,让你不断重新启动,甚至在午夜时分唤醒你。对于操作系统优化来说,是尽可能的增大可使用的内存容量、提高CPU 的频率,保证文件系统的读写速率等。经过压力测试验证,在并发连接很多的情况下,CPU 的处理能力越强,系统运行速度越快 ...
分类:
其他好文 时间:
2018-12-29 14:32:52
阅读次数:
214
问题:如何从从外部读取函数局部变量? 解决方法:在函数的内部,再定义一个函数 从js的作用域结构我们可以知道函数 lazy_sum可以读取sum中的局部变量和参数,那么只要把sum作为返回值,我们不就可以在lazy_sum外部读取它的内部变量了吗! 在这个例子中,我们在函数lazy_sum中又定义了 ...
分类:
其他好文 时间:
2018-12-28 23:34:44
阅读次数:
296
cpu的主频=外频x倍频 cpu的主频不能完全决定cpu的性能,只是cpu性能的一个参数 cpu的外频是cpu的基准频率,它决定着整个主板的运行速度,超频超的是cpu的外频 IPC:cpu每一个时钟周期内所执行的指令的多少 IPC的提供: 1.提高cpu微架构并行度 2.采用多核架构 集成缓存——缓 ...
分类:
其他好文 时间:
2018-12-25 13:17:35
阅读次数:
191
今天介绍下Psyco模块,Psyco模块可以使你的Python程序运行的像C语言一样快。都说Python语言易用易学,但性能上跟一些编译语言(如C语言)比较要差不少,这里可以用C语言和Python语言各编写斐波纳契数列计算程序,并计算运行时间: C语言程序 复制代码代码如下: int fib(int ...
分类:
编程语言 时间:
2018-12-24 00:17:39
阅读次数:
256
我们知道,python作为一种几乎是脚本语言的语言,其优点固然有,但是其有一个最大的缺点,就是运行速度没有办法和c,c++,java比。最近在些一些代码的时候也是碰到了这样的问题。 具体而言,python想提速度,基本思路是两个,有个就jit技术,在python中比较好用的就是pypy;另外一种就是 ...
分类:
编程语言 时间:
2018-12-24 00:14:56
阅读次数:
335
三个类的主要区别在于运行速度与线程安全;运行速度:StringBuilder > StringBuffer > String原因:StringBuilder和StringBuffer是变量,String是常量;若String str = "abc"; str += "de";,str被初始化为abc ...
分类:
其他好文 时间:
2018-12-17 23:57:01
阅读次数:
230
首先来看split的源码: 通过split方法的源码可以发现,在大部分情况下,split函数实际上是新建了一个Pattern对象,再去调用它的split函数,因此,如果我们一直调用String的split方法,就相当于在一直新建Pattern对象,会明显多占用内存,降低程序运行速度。此时可以对代码进 ...
分类:
其他好文 时间:
2018-12-17 22:36:04
阅读次数:
234
组合逻辑与时序逻辑 组合逻辑电路:任意时刻电路输出的逻辑状态仅仅取决于当时输入的逻辑状态,而与电路过去的工作状态无关。 时序逻辑电路:任意时刻电路输出的逻辑状态不仅取决于当时输入的逻辑状态,而与电路过去的工作状态有关。 在电路的结构上,时序逻辑电路肯定包含有存储电路,而且输出一定与存储电路的状态有关 ...
分类:
其他好文 时间:
2018-12-17 20:08:15
阅读次数:
429
JIT与Dalvik JIT是"Just In Time Compiler"的缩写,就是"即时编译技术",与Dalvik虚拟机相关。 怎么理解这句话呢?这要从Android的一些特性说起。 JIT是在2.2版本提出的,目的是为了提高Android的运行速度,一直存活到4.4版本,因为在4.4之后的R ...
分类:
其他好文 时间:
2018-12-17 20:07:26
阅读次数:
181
JDKVersion1.01996-01-23Oak(橡树)初代版本,伟大的一个里程碑,但是是纯解释运行,使用外挂JIT,性能比较差,运行速度慢。JDKVersion1.11997-02-19JDBC(JavaDataBaseConnectivity);支持内部类;RMI(RemoteMethodInvocation);反射;JavaBean;JDKVersion1.21998-12-08Play
分类:
编程语言 时间:
2018-12-17 02:37:33
阅读次数:
219